/*
helper > sleep
*/
function sleep( ms )
{
return new Promise( ( resolve ) =>
{
setTimeout( resolve, ms );
});
}
/*
Semaphore > Declare
allows multiple threads to work with the same shared resources
*/
class Semaphore
{
constructor( max )
{
this.max = max;
this.queue = [];
this.active = 0;
}
async acquire()
{
if ( this.active < this.max )
{
this.active++;
return;
}
return new Promise( ( resolve ) => this.queue.push( resolve ) );
}
release()
{
this.active--;
if ( this.queue.length > 0 )
{
const resolve = this.queue.shift();
this.active++;
resolve();
}
}
}
/*
Semaphore > Initialize
@arg int threads_max
*/
const semaphore = new Semaphore( 5 );
